From d2ed3e5614f0ee1d1c568612500279d754bf3044 Mon Sep 17 00:00:00 2001 From: Steffen Schuemann Date: Sun, 19 May 2019 22:10:08 +0200 Subject: [PATCH] Work on better CI integration. --- .travis.yml | 11 +++++++++-- 1 file changed, 9 insertions(+), 2 deletions(-) diff --git a/.travis.yml b/.travis.yml index 7a0adbb..37e723f 100644 --- a/.travis.yml +++ b/.travis.yml @@ -67,8 +67,15 @@ before_script: script: - export VERBOSE=1 - - cmake --build . --config ${CONFIG} - - ctest -C ${CONFIG} -E Windows + - cmake --build . --config ${CONFIG} --target filesystem_test + - | + if [ "${GHC_COVERAGE}" = "1" ]; then + cmake --build . --config ${CONFIG} --target filesystem_test + test/filesystem_test + else + cmake --build . --config ${CONFIG} + ctest -C ${CONFIG} -E Windows + fi after_success: - |